Output 70ef907028589384e299554cb4308bfadeae5c5b0e931823f9fcfa88cc091b83:47

value
18973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7085feb7a49f46b4d1440c983fd7e63ffb432182 OP_EQUAL
address
3Bwz8ATUrhRD3rzT2BrF8qxykHW4KRUvUF
transaction
70ef907028589384e299554cb4308bfadeae5c5b0e931823f9fcfa88cc091b83
spent
true